Photocure ASA: Results for the fourth quarter of 2025

Photocure ASA (OSE: PHO) today reported Hexvix®/Cysview® revenues of NOK 135.1 million in the fourth quarter of 2025 (Q4 2024: NOK 128.6 million), and a commercial EBITDA of NOK 8.4 million (Q4 2024: NOK 3.9 million) for the company. In 2026, Photocure expects product revenue growth in the range of 7% to 11% on a constant currency basis and continued operating leverage flow-through in its core Hexvix®/Cysview® commercial business.
